Abstract
The utility model discloses a fire alarm detector with smoke sensing function, which belongs to the field of fire alarm detectors and comprises a detector shell, wherein a mounting seat is fixedly arranged at the top of the detector shell, a mounting groove is formed in the outer surface of the detector shell, an alarm lamp is fixedly arranged in the mounting groove, a buzzer is fixedly arranged on the outer surface of the detector shell on one side of the alarm lamp, an electric plate, a data receiving chip and a smoke sensor are respectively and fixedly arranged in the detector shell from top to bottom, a data transmission chip and a single chip microcomputer are fixedly arranged on the electric plate, and a signal transmitter is fixedly arranged in the mounting seat; the utility model discloses an including installing smoke transducer, smoke transducer can detect the smog concentration of environment at any time, if smog concentration exceeds standard, then the device can automatic drive sound peak ware and warning light report to the police, effectively predicts the conflagration dangerous situation in advance.

Referring to fig. 1-4, the utility model provides a fire alarm detector with smoke sensing function, including detector shell 4, detector shell 4's top fixed mounting has mount pad 2, detector shell 4 has seted up mounting groove 5 on the surface, fixed mounting has warning light 6 in the mounting groove 5, warning light 6 one side is located detector shell 4's surface fixed mounting has bee calling organ 7, detector shell 4's inside is from last to down respectively fixed mounting has electroplax 9, data receiving chip 13 and smoke transducer 11, electroplax 9 is last fixed mounting has data transmission chip 10 and singlechip 12, mount pad 2's inside fixed mounting has signal transmitter 8;
the output of smoke sensor 11 and the input electric connection of data receiving chip 13, the output of data receiving chip 13 and the input electric connection of data transmission chip 10, the output of data transmission chip 10 and the input electric connection of singlechip 12, the output of singlechip 12 respectively with warning light 6, buzzer 7 and the input electric connection of signal transmitter 8, signal transmitter 8 and terminal host network connection, smoke sensor 11, data transmission chip 10, singlechip 12 and data receiving chip 13 all with electroplax 9 electric connection, warning light 6, buzzer 7, signal transmitter 8 and electroplax 9 all with external power supply electric connection.
In the above scheme, install the device on the top surface in the building through mount pad 2, fix through installation screw 1, when the environment has dense smoke to produce, smoke transducer 11 detects dense smoke concentration, if surpass smoke transducer 11's detection standard, singlechip 12 can automatic control warning light 6 and buzzer 7 work, warning light 6 opens the scintillation, buzzer 7 reports to the police, warn personnel in the floor, effectively predict the conflagration dangerous situation in advance, time has been won for follow-up saving, signal transmitter 8 can be with signal transmission to terminal host computer on, thereby terminal host computer can receive the dangerous situation, thereby take counter-measures rapidly, people can take effective measure just before the conflagration takes place and avoid the conflagration hidden danger.
Specifically, a mounting screw 1 is arranged in the mounting seat 2 through threads; the mounting screw 1 enables the mounting base 2 to be fixedly mounted on the top surface of the floor.
Specifically, the outer part of the mounting seat 2 is provided with a signal hole 3; the signal aperture 3 may reserve an antenna aperture for the signal transmitter 8.
Specifically, two smoke sensors 11 are symmetrically arranged about the longitudinal central axis of the detector housing 4; the double smoke sensors 11 can monitor the smoke concentration at the same time, and the smoke concentration monitoring accuracy is improved.
Specifically, a plurality of flue gas holes 14 are formed in the bottom surface of the detector shell 4; the flue gas port 14 allows ambient flue gas to enter the detector housing 4.
Specifically, two signal transmitters 8 are symmetrically installed about the longitudinal central axis of the mounting base 2; the double signal emitter 8 can effectively ensure the stability of the signal transmission process.
It should be noted that: the type of the alarm lamp 6 can be 48-70W2, the type of the buzzer 7 can be BL-PBZ12085CYB, the type of the signal transmitter 8 can be DG5101, the type of the electric plate 9 can be TU933, the type of the data transmission chip 10 can be NC4410, the type of the smoke sensor 11 can be MQ-2, the type of the singlechip 12 can be AT89C2051, and the type of the data receiving chip 13 can be XC43 4366 BL.
The utility model discloses a theory of operation and use flow: install the device on the top surface in the building through mount pad 2, fix through installation screw 1, when the environment has dense smoke to produce, smoke transducer 11 detects dense smoke concentration, if surpass smoke transducer 11's detection standard, then singlechip 12 can automatic control warning light 6 and buzzer 7 work, the flashing is opened to warning light 6, buzzer 7 reports to the police, personnel in the floor warn, and signal transmitter 8 can be with on signal transmission to the terminal host computer, thereby the terminal host computer can receive the dangerous situation, thereby take counter-measures rapidly.
